
The 2-axis industrial Delta robot is a small, high-speed parallel industrial robot, generally consisting of a moving platform and a static platform connected by two chains: an active arm and a passive arm. The mechanism has two degrees of freedom. Compared with the 3-axis industrial Delta robot, the working space of the 2-axis industrial Delta robot is on an XZ plane, whereas the working space of the 3-axis industrial Delta robot is a three-dimensional space with XYZ directions. The 2-axis industrial Delta robot is more suitable for point-to-point planar movements compared to the 3-axis industrial Delta robot.
